我只想允许用户选择星期五。基本上,他们是在选择时间表的开始日期,而时间表必须始终在星期五开始。
我真的不关心其他日子是否显示,只要显示,那么它们就会被禁用。
最佳答案
您可以使用 beforeShowDate
option ,像这样:
$("#datepicker").datepicker({
beforeShowDay: function(date) {
return [date.getDay() == 5];
}
});
You can try a demo here ,我们只是检查是否 .getDay()
它试图显示的日期是 5
(星期五),如果是,则 true
是数组中的第一个元素,否则为 false
禁用选择器中的日期。
关于javascript - Jquery UI 日期选择器...只允许星期五?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3151331/